What denomination is Pittsburgh Theological Seminary?
Denomination. Presbyterian Church (U.S.A.)
Is ATS an accredited school?
The ATS Commission on Accrediting provides graduate schools of theology with accreditation. It is recognized by both the Council for Higher Education Accreditation and the United States Department of Education as an accrediting body.
Is Pittsburgh Theological Seminary conservative?
PTS is affiliated with the theologically progressive Presbyterian Church (U.S.A.). RPTS is governed by the theologically conservative Reformed Presbyterian Church of North America. The students at each identify with a range of religious denominations.
Is the Pittsburgh Theological Seminary accredited?
Pittsburgh Theological Seminary is accredited by the Association of Theological Schools in the United States and Canada and the Middle States Commission on Higher Education.
How do I know if my seminary is accredited?
How do I find out if a seminary is accredited by the Commission on Accrediting? The Member Schools directory lists institutions alphabetically, geographically, and by denomination. Each school's listing indicates its membership status.

What is Work Support Program at Pittsburgh Theological Seminary?
The Work Support Program at Pittsburgh Theological Seminary is an initiative designed to provide financial assistance to students through work opportunities within the seminary community, helping to alleviate educational costs while fostering professional development.
Who is required to file Work Support Program at Pittsburgh Theological Seminary?
Students enrolled at Pittsburgh Theological Seminary who wish to participate in the Work Support Program and receive financial assistance are typically required to file for the program.
How to fill out Work Support Program at Pittsburgh Theological Seminary?
To fill out the Work Support Program application, students must complete the designated application form available from the seminary's administration, providing necessary personal and financial information as well as any required documentation.
What is the purpose of Work Support Program at Pittsburgh Theological Seminary?
The purpose of the Work Support Program is to assist students financially by providing them with job opportunities that support their education and reduce their overall tuition costs.
What information must be reported on Work Support Program at Pittsburgh Theological Seminary?
Students must report personal identification details, financial need, work preferences, and any relevant academic information when applying for the Work Support Program.
